/// Converts unary and binary standard operations to SPIR-V operations.
template <typename Op, typename SPIRVOp>
class UnaryAndBinaryOpPattern final : public OpConversionPattern<Op> {
public:
  using OpConversionPattern<Op>::OpConversionPattern;

  LogicalResult
  matchAndRewrite(Op op, typename Op::Adaptor adaptor,
                  ConversionPatternRewriter &rewriter) const override {
    assert(adaptor.getOperands().size() <= 2);
    auto dstType = this->getTypeConverter()->convertType(op.getType());
    if (!dstType)
      return failure();
    if (SPIRVOp::template hasTrait<OpTrait::spirv::UnsignedOp>() &&
        dstType != op.getType()) {
      return op.emitError(
          "bitwidth emulation is not implemented yet on unsigned op");
    }
    rewriter.template replaceOpWithNewOp<SPIRVOp>(op, dstType,
                                                  adaptor.getOperands());
    return success();
  }
};
